Commonly Confused Words

Some words have the same or similar sound as another word, but the spelling and meaning are different.
Look at these pairs of commonly confused words.

affect (verb) to influence or touch the feelings of someone


effect (noun) result
accept (verb) to receive something
except (prep.) but
ascent (noun) rising, going up
assent (noun) agreement, (verb) to agree
advice (noun) guidance or recommendations
advise (verb) to give guidance or recommendations
aid (noun) assistance, (verb) to assist
aide (noun) an assistant
desert (noun) a dry area
dessert (noun) a sweet dish served at the end of a meal
later (adj.) the comparative form of « late »
latter (ad.) refers to the second of two people or things previously mentioned
passed (verb) past tense form of « pass »
past (noun) a previous time, (adj.) gone by in time, (prep.) on the far side
sight (noun) something seen; the ability to see
site (noun) location
than (conj.) used when making comparisons
then (adv.) at that time; next
